To improve knowledge of the bottlenose dolphin (Tursiops truncatus) and its relationship with artisanal and purse seine fishing and with marine protected areas.
Specific objectives of the project
OE1 Determine the positive or negative effects of artisanal gillnet and purse seine fishing gear on bottlenose dolphins in marine protected areas and adjacent waters.
OE2 To determine the possible effects on artisanal gillnet and purse seine fisheries derived from the interaction of bottlenose dolphins in marine protected areas and adjacent waters.
OE3 Propose management measures for artisanal and purse seine fishing and bottlenose dolphins based on the results obtained.
OE4 Involve artisanal and purse seine fishermen in the conservation of these species.
OE5 Raise awareness of marine protected species and areas in the fishing fleet and the local population.
Navigation campaigns will be carried out to determine population parameters of the bottlenose dolphin population present in the study area and its degree of interaction with fishing activities, together with data collection through hydrophones and embarkation in purse seiners to document the interactions that occur in this type of gear, which takes place during the night. Once the information has been obtained and analyzed, meetings will be held with the affected fishermen to propose possible management and mitigation measures that can be carried out.
